Output ed7d21d667287bf4347eaf695976f43837fbbd03e1d5ceda3d7b57ca3ea12214:86

value
844302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e96d6f319a5601aae3e65bd8ad20f0fc28ec5d10 OP_EQUAL
address
3NyGTsYR27t1use8EHSWMJanf8TFpyzxsX
transaction
ed7d21d667287bf4347eaf695976f43837fbbd03e1d5ceda3d7b57ca3ea12214
confirmations
3451
spent
true